    In microscopy, negative staining is an established method, often used in diagnostic microscopy, for contrasting a thin specimen with an optically opaque fluid. In this technique, the background is stained, leaving the actual specimen untouched, and thus visible. This contrasts with positive staining, in which the actual specimen is stained.

    The bath consists of three containers filled with water at different temperatures: the first is set at 100 °C to liquefy the agar, the second is used to lower down the temperature of the material for safe intra-oral use (usually set at 43–46 °C) and the third one is used for storage and is set at 63–66 °C.

    [1] More sophisticated varieties of plaque disclosing agents contain several dyes, which selectively stain plaque of different ages. With the most common variety, immature plaque stains red, mature purple, and pathological acidic plaque blue. This is owing to the blue dye washing off immature plaque, and acid degrading the red dye.

    The Ziehl-Neelsen stain is a two step staining process. In the first step, the tissue is stained with a basic fuchsin solution, which stains all cells pink. In the second step, the tissue is incubated in an acid alcohol solution, which decolorizes all cells except for acid-fast cells, which retain the color and appeared as red.
